How Bats Get In
Bats only need a tiny opening—often as small as ⅜ of an inch—to squeeze into your attic. Common entry points include gaps near the roofline, attic vents, fascia boards, and chimneys. Once they’ve found a quiet space, especially in summer when maternal colonies form, they can stay for months unnoticed.
Why Bats Are a Serious Problem
Unlike raccoons or squirrels, bats usually don’t chew wires or wood—but the real danger lies in their droppings, known as guano.
Here’s what makes them a major problem:
- Health Hazards – Bat guano can carry a fungus that leads to Histoplasmosis, a serious lung infection caused by breathing in spores. This risk increases as the guano dries out and becomes airborne.
- Odor and Contamination – Bat urine and droppings create a strong ammonia-like smell that can saturate insulation, drywall, and even structural wood.
- Structural Damage – Large amounts of guano are acidic and can corrode wood, insulation, and metal surfaces over time.
- Bat Bugs – Similar to bed bugs, these parasites can move into living spaces once the bats are gone if the cleanup isn’t handled properly.
Legal Protection = No DIY Removal
Bats are protected by law in many states, including Kansas and Missouri, meaning you can’t simply trap or kill them. Removal must be handled using humane exclusion techniques—at the right time of year—to avoid separating mothers from their pups.
